1. Safeguarding Food Safety and Eliminating Contamination Risks
Oil-free air compressors effectively prevent oil contamination. In traditional air compressors, oil serves as an essential lubricant. However, during the air compression process, this oil can become entrained in the airflow, leading to air contamination. In food production environments, the presence of oil contaminants in the air can have severe repercussions for food hygiene and safety. Oil-free air compressors eliminate the need for oil-based lubrication, thereby preventing such contamination.

4. Compatible with Sterile Cleanroom Environments; Preserving Food Flavor, Quality, and Shelf Life
Production facilities for dairy products, beverages, baked goods, frozen foods, and snack items all operate within high-standard sterile environments. Oil-free air compressors do not generate oily exhaust fumes or compromise the cleanliness of the workshop, making them perfectly suited to meet the rigorous demands of such production environments.
Oil-based impurities can alter a food product’s original texture, color, and aroma; furthermore, they accelerate the oxidation and spoilage of ingredients, thereby shortening the product’s shelf life. A pure air supply does not interfere with the physicochemical properties of food products, thereby maximizing the preservation of natural flavors and ensuring consistent product quality.
5. Compliance with Strict Industry Testing and Entry Standards
For critical processes such as food filling, sealing and packaging, ingredient mixing, and automated packaging, industry regulations explicitly mandate the use of oil-free compressed air.
The adoption of oil-free equipment is essential for successfully passing sanitary spot checks and qualification audits, thereby ensuring the smooth market launch and distribution of products.

During the production process, compressed air frequently comes into direct contact with raw ingredients, semi-finished goods, and packaging materials. If the air contains oil—as is the case with oil-lubricated systems—oil mist and grease particles can adhere to food surfaces or become entrained within beverages, baked goods, and meat products. This poses a severe risk of food contamination and can trigger critical food safety issues. Class 0 oil-free air compressors, however, generate a source of pure, oil-free air, thereby eliminating the risk of oil contamination at the very source and ensuring full compliance with national food safety production standards.
